Literature Against Dogma: An Agnostic Defense

Acclaimed novelist and academic Tabish Khair argues that literature, as a distinct mode of thinking, can counteract fundamentalism.

Literature is a mode of thought, stories being one of the oldest thinking ‘devices’ known to humankind. About The Author

Tabish Khair

Tabish Khair is an Indian writer, academic and journalist, born (1966) and educated in the small town of Gaya in Bihar, India. After finishing his MA from Gaya, he completed a PhD at Copenhagen University and a DPhil at Aarhus University, Denmark, where he is now an Associate Professor. He has been a visiting professor or research fellow at various universities and has received Carlsberg, Leverhulme, and other academic grants. Khair is also an internationally published novelist.
